MindPetal, established in 2006, has evolved into a leading provider of automation and digital transformation solutions for federal government agencies [1]. With a team of 150 technical experts, the company delivers smart, secure digital solutions, data management, and AI/ML capabilities. Their 2023 acquisition of VerticalApps has further enhanced their ability to address emerging AI-powered government initiatives while building upon their 18-year legacy of technical innovation [2].

MindPetal's comprehensive federal contracting presence spans multiple agencies and contract vehicles, demonstrating broad market penetration through:
- GSA IT Schedule 70 (Contract No. GS-35F-0500W)
- NIH CIO-SP3 8(a) (Contract No. HHSN316201200089)
- NIH CIO-SP3 Small Business (Contract No. HHSN316201200157W)
- Department of Labor OCIO Case Management BPA (Contract No. 1605DC-18A-0046)
- Department of Labor OCIO IT Operations & Management IDIQ (Contract No. 1605DC-19-F-00028)
- FAA eFAST Contract (Contract No. 693KA9-22-A-00047)
- USDA DISC Intelligent Automation BPA (Contract No. 12314423A0020)
